2

私は数年間潜んでいますが、ここで答えられていない質問があると思います.

昨夜、または SQL サーバーでかなり集中的なメンテナンスを行っていました。または、プライマリ データベースの mdb ファイルが非常に断片化されていました。テストと概念実証のために、このデータベースのテスト コピーを保持しています。

テスト データベースでログ配布をセットアップしましたが、最初にログ配布を削除せずに、何も考えずにテスト データベースを削除しました。エラー 14421 が発生します - ログ配布セカンダリ データベース SERVER.database の復元しきい値は 45 分で、同期されていません。10310 分間、リストアは実行されませんでした。復元された待ち時間は 0 分です。エージェント ログとログ配布モニターの情報を確認します。

tsql でできることはすべて削除しました。私の調査によると、このエラーはバックアップ ジョブがまだ動作しようとしていることが原因であると思われますが、このジョブを削除することができません。大したことではありませんが、ログに数分ごとにエラーが表示されます。

何か私にできることはありますか?

前もって感謝します!

4

1 に答える 1

2

ログ配布情報は、データベース自体ではなく、MSDB に保存されます。必要なのは、削除されたデータベースと同じ名前で新しいデータベースを作成することだけです。プロパティ、ログ配布タブを右クリックし、ボックスのチェックを外してデータベースをログ配布します。[OK] をクリックすると、(プライマリとセカンダリの) ジョブが削除されます。

于 2014-12-03T03:56:11.857 に答える